About Enhanced Multi Store For Magento 2.

Multi-store module for Magento 2 allows you to show different Brands or Languages in the header of your store, while offering the possibility to navigate between these store-views.

This flexible solution enables the merchant to display the store-view Brands or Languages in the header of each store, offering the end user an omnichannel experience while purchasing on the website. The end user wil be able to purchse from any store-view and checkout with the same account.

With this extension you can have multiple store-views share cart, user sessions, payment gateways, and so on, but with separate catalog structures and page presentation while making the user aware that you are selling under multiple brands or languages.

You don't have to start from scratch with your new brand, but take advantage of the popularity of your main brand and add the rest of the brands in the header of your store. Example: one domain www.zara.com with multiple brands: Zara , Zara Kids, Zara Home

Features of the Extension.

  • Allows to easy create a Multi-Brand store and show the brands on all stores with the possibility to surf between the store-views.
  • Create store-views for different languages on the same Magento 2 installation, and display the language flags in order to change the language.
  • Multiple admin options for enhanced control and design.
  • Mobile responsive.
  • Easy installation.
  • Quality code.

Web Merchandisers question:

"I want the possibility to have different storeviews for different brands in the same magento installation, and display the brands on all storeviews in order to allow the customer to surf between each shop."

The Solution:

This extension allows you to do that. You can configure the brand image for each store, and it will show on all stores in the header, allowing the customer to scroll between your brands and have access to different products while keeping an omnichannel experience.

Web Merchandisers question:

" I want the end user to be able to checkout using the same account while purchasing from all storeviews in order to have an omnichannel experience."

The Solution:

This extension allows you to this possibility. Under the same Magento Website, you can create multiple store views and assign a different brand to each store-view. The user will be able to checkout using the same Magento account while purchasing from different Brand shops.



  • Step 1:
    Before installing please check the extension compatibility. This extension is currently compatible with the following Magento versions 2.3.X. - 2.4.2. It is recommended to install the extension first on a testing server before you install it on a live (production) server.
  • Step 2:
    Make sure you have your Magento Marketplace Authentication Keys configured on the Magento instance. If your keys are not added, check the Magento Documentation for more information about how to add those.
  • Step 3:
    Access the root of your magento 2 project from command line and run the following commands:
    composer require weltpixel/m2-weltpixel-multistore
    php bin/magento setup:upgrade
    php bin/magento setup:di:compile
    php bin/magento setup:static-content:deploy -f




  • Go to WeltPixel > Multistore > General Configuration > Enable and set this option to [ Yes ]; Make sure you have multiple storeviews created in order for the brand/language images to show up in your header.
  • Redirect to Home Page on store switch allows you to chose if you want to be redirected to the homepage when the store / language is activated, or remain on the current page and only change the language; This option can be used when you have different products on each store and you want to redirect the end user to homepage when changing the brand.
  • Set Active Store Image in order to know which store / language option is active; should be a different image than the inactive image, in order to highlight that this shop is not Selected and Active.
  • Set Inactive Store Image this image will be displayed as logo when another store /language is selected; should be a different image than the active image, in order to highlight that this shop is not active, you can use inverted colors or transparency to achieve this.
  • Set Display in one row desktop displays the store view at the top in a single row; If this option is Enabled, all the brands or language flags will be displayed in a single row on top of the header. If this option is Disabled the imges will show in the header instead of the Store-View selector. This option is for desktop.
  • Set Set the storeview switcher as dropdown desktop Select Yes, in order to display the Store switcher as a dropdown.
  • Set Display in frontend desktop Select what information to displayed. Store Name only, Flag only, Flag and Store name.
  • Set Display in one row mobile displays the store view at the top in a single row; If this option is Enabled, all the brands or language flags will be displayed in a single row on top of the header. If this option is Disabled the imges will show in the header instead of the Store-View selector. This option is for mobile.
  • Set Display in frontend mobile Select what information to displayed. Store Name only, Flag only, Flag and Store name.
  • Visibility on storefront allows you to set the visibility on storefront; If this option is Disabled, the selected store-view image will not show up on the rest of the storeviews, allowing you to have an isolated store that will not show up in the Brand/Language images.
  • Logo Height and Width allows you to set the dimensions of the logo in the menu or top bar. You can only fill in the Height area in px, and the width will autoscale.
  • Exclude stores this option allows you to hide Brand/Language images in the current storeview while showing on others. It is usefull when for certain geographical areas you want to show only specific store-view languages and not all available languages.

Change Log.

What’s new in v.1.10.7 - March 26, 2021

  • Fixed an issue which sometimes prevented store-views from showing in the menu on mobile.
  • Excluded Magento 2.0.x - 2.2.x from new features and fixes starting with this release.
  • Adjusted WeltPixel Developer section comments.

What’s new in v.1.10.5 - February 12, 2021

  • Fixed a bug that sometimes caused the Store-View Switcher to disappear when the module was disabled.
  • Made Magento Admin extension options comment improvements.
  • Confirmed compatibility with the newly released Magento 2.4.2 version.
  • Added additional backend versioning verifications.
  • Backend module code optimizations.

What’s new in v.1.10.1 - October 22, 2020

  • Added CSS adjustments related to the Multistore height.
  • Confirmed compatibility with the newly released Magento 2.4.1 version.

What’s new in v.1.10.0 - August 10, 2020

  • New Feature: Added the ability to add country flags or other images to the default Magento Store Switcher.
  • Confirmed compatibility with the newly released Magento 2.4.0 version.

What’s new in v.1.9.8 - July 6, 2020

  • Fixed an bug which prevented uploaded logos from displaying when the Display in one Row feature was enabled, on Header V2. This only affected users of the Pearl Theme.
  • Whitelisted domain for Content Security Policies introduced in Magento 2.3.5.

What’s new in v.1.9.7 - May 7, 2020

  • Fixed an error reported on Magento 2.3.0 related to an unused viewModel.
  • Confirmed compatibility with Magento 2.3.5.
  • Implemented small Backend performance optimizations.
  • Added nxcli.net (Nexcess temporary URL) as a valid domain in the licensing process.
  • Added an option in the Developer section to allow for switching Magento's CSP between "report-only" and "restrict".

What’s new in v.1.9.6 - April 9, 2020

  • Fixed a Backend issue on Magento Commerce whereby the Category Schedule functionality was not working properly.

What’s new in v.1.9.5 - March 10, 2020

  • Added backend Google reCaptcha compatibility for Magento 2.3.x

What’s new in v.1.9.4 - February 5, 2020

  • Code enhancements for increased security. Changed User Group info collection method.
  • Confirmed compatibility for Magento 2.3.4.

What’s new in v.1.9.2 - November 27, 2019

  • Fixed an issue which caused the Multistore icons to disappear when scrolling the page down and back up again.
  • Fixed a small bug which prevented the Redirect to Home Page functionality from working correctly.
  • Added Magento and PHP version in the WeltPixel Developer section.

What’s new in v.1.9.1 - October 16, 2019

  • Fixed a mobile scroll issue that occured when the extension was enabled.
  • Fixed a bug which caused the frontend to break when using Header V2 and the Multistore module was disabled.
  • Confirmed compatibility with the latst Magento 2.3.3 version.
  • Included the WeSupply Toolbox integration extension - Proactive Notifications Email & SMS, Returns & RMA, Store Locator, Delivery Date Estimate, Logistics Analytics, NPS & CSAT score. Get Free on-boarding and launch within 24 hours.

What’s new in v.1.9.0 - July 18, 2019

  • Confirmed compatibility with Magento 2.3.2.
  • Added HTTPS endpoint for licensing process.

What’s new in v.1.8.5 - June 7, 2019

  • Fixed a bug where the HomePage Redirect functionality was not working correctly.
  • Fixed an issue which prevented the extension from being disabled.
  • Small performance improvements.

What’s new in v.1.8.4 - April 25, 2019

  • Fixed an bug that caused display issues for the logo uploader in the admin.
  • Added PHP version in the WeltPixel Developer Section.

What’s new in v.1.8.3 - April 3rd, 2019

  • Confirmed compatibility for Magento 2.3.1.

What’s new in v.1.8.2 - January 24, 2019

  • Added possibility to choose the color of the Multistore bar when displayed in one row.
  • Added possibility to set the width of the Multistore bar when displayed in one row.
  • Helpcenter adjustment, removed Zendesk iframe and added a simple link to our Support Center in order to avoid any potential conflicts with other admin js added by 3rd party extensions.
  • Fix for multiple rewritten ImageFactory classes, rewrite check validity, rewrite checks optimizations.

What’s new in v.1.8.0 - December 8, 2018

  • Compatibility adjustments for Magento 2.1.16/2.2.7/2.3.1.
  • PHP 7.2 compatibility added.
  • As Magento 2.3 comes with major core changes, we have provided a different set of files in order to achieve the best performance on each version.

What’s new in v.1.7.5 - October 24, 2018

  • Added detailed error messages for invalid licenses for an easier identification of the cause.
  • License improvements, added *.magento.cloud as a valid test domain for Enterprise Cloud environments. Now both ‘magentosite.cloud’ and ‘magneto.cloud’ can be used for testing purpose with the production domain license.

What’s new in v.1.7.4 - September 25, 2018

  • Admin menu styling to fit screen size 1366px.
  • Fix for production mode with merged JS - missing color pallet display now fixed.

What’s new in v.1.7.3 - August 23, 2018

  • License improvements, adding *.magento.cloud as a valid test domain.

What’s new in v.1.7.2 - August 2, 2018

  • Fixed admin random logout issue.
  • Licensing improvements, allowing 3 letter domain as valid domain.

What’s new in v.1.7.0 - July 5, 2018

  • Added option to enable/disable WeltPixel admin notifications.
  • Show store and server related information under debugging tab: Magento Mode, Magento Edition, Server User, Magento Installation Path, Current server time, Latest cron jobs.
  • Added licensing, license key needs to be generated under weltpixel.com account for purchased product, based on domain name and added under your magento installation.

What’s new in v.1.6.4 - May 16, 2018

  • Compatibility with Magento 2.2.4, logger broken reference fix, changed to rewrite from plugin.
  • Removed duplicated slash from image src.

What’s new in v.1.6.1 - March 8, 2018

  • System log broken reference error fixes.

What’s new in v.1.5.8 - January 12, 2018

  • Added version control for installed WeltPixel modules, including latest version check.

What’s new in v.1.5.7 - December 14, 2017

  • Added Support Center functionality in Magento Admin.
  • Added Debugger functionality, checks for rewrites and points potential issues.
  • Added language bar min height for desktop and mobile.

What’s new in v.1.5.3 - September 20, 2017

  • Removing hover effect from active multi-store image.

What’s new in v.1.0.0 - 07/24/2017

  • Initial release